Hi Glenn, on the heels of the last Megasteam question, in your opinion, what would be the best way to approach this?
Installing a MST513. Also installing a 7K BTU radiant zone, and a 50 gallon indirect. Would it be best to use an Everhot RH8 on the condensate for both (no priority) or should I use the tankless for one or both zones? Or, use the RH8 (or not) for the indirect, and the tankless for the radiant?
Figure on the typical Alliance head loss, the radiant head loss is 11.2 with two loops-3.4 with three loops.

I would pipe the Indirect as a vacuum loop using the Indirect tappings provided and the Radiant using the coil but with at least a mixing valve, expansion tank, PRV and relief valve. This way the bulk of your flow will be in the radiant system loop with a little flow through the coil only when more temperature is needed. The mixing sevice will also protect the pipe against higher temperatures when the boiler is making steam. Wire both zones through a high limit aquastat mounted in the tapping provided. It may make more sense to use an additional aquastat for the radiant loop since it doesn't hotter water temperature like the indirect.
